SVERRE STOJE– Utilising internal entrepreneurs to get through crisis: Experiences from organisations in Europe and Russia
Stoje enjoys helping organisations that spans more than one culture to align their people with strategy. During tough times some companies dare to use their internal entrepreneurs to boost the employees’ moral, improve internal systems, expand their customer base and sales and also increase the company’s profit. Stoje will share his experiences from working with such companies in Europe and Russia and give examples of how successes were achieved and also why things went wrong.
Sverre has a background as a lawyer, diplomat and HR Executive and has among different assignments been director of intrapreneurship programs. Stoje runs his own advisory service with South East Asia as his main geographical focus.
